Output f5d238d29408f5cdd2132e8e10aa5755b9226286307a244e7d8dd22b4bf06c74:7

value
338302735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b66b66e7fc88603044dc8b13f24ce06291846ba OP_EQUAL
address
MLcFCh8tMDX6FKwuUvGysnjA5EhRXxFNiB
transaction
f5d238d29408f5cdd2132e8e10aa5755b9226286307a244e7d8dd22b4bf06c74
spent
true